1982 Renken Bowrider I got from my dad and have lovingly restored.
OMC 120 horse
Stringer outdrive
PROBLEM:Won't shift into/out of gear.

The lower unit was rebuilt a few years back but I cracked the foot off anyway to check, fluid looks clean, no metal in there and the gears look nice and healthy. This leads me to believe it is the notorious shift cable. I read somewhere that the short end of the cable - when the long is pulled out all the way is supposed to measure 4 7/8" mine is 6 1/2" I also know there are 2 different models of this out drive and I have no clue which it is, maybe 6 1/2 is right, maybe it's stretched out like a.... stringer cable :)

Is there any way I can measure or and #s that would indicate what cable I need and the proper measurements?
